Ask Dr. Agus: COVID-19 public health emergency to end in May
The White House announced it will end COVID-19 emergency declarations on May 11, more than three years into the pandemic. CBS News medical contributor Dr. David Agus joined Anne-Marie Green and Janet Shamlian to discuss the move. He also explains the side effects of Ozempic and takes questions from the public.
